John McWhorter
John H. McWhorter is an associate professor of English and comparative literature at Columbia University. John is also a contributing writer at The Atlantic and the author of more than a dozen books, including The Power of Babel: A Natural History of Language and Words on the Move: Why English Won't - and Can't - Sit Still (Like, Literally).
